一、系统架构设计:模块化与可扩展性
智能客服系统的核心架构需包含知识库管理模块、对话引擎模块和用户交互接口三大组件,各模块间通过标准化API实现解耦。
-
知识库管理模块
采用”分层存储+动态更新”机制:- 基础层:存储FAQ、操作手册等结构化文档(JSON/XML格式)
- 扩展层:对接业务系统数据库(如MySQL/PostgreSQL)实时获取动态数据
- 缓存层:使用Redis缓存高频查询结果,将响应时间控制在200ms以内
示例知识条目结构:
{"id": "HR-001","question": "如何申请年假?","answer": "员工可通过OA系统提交申请,需提前3个工作日...","keywords": ["年假", "请假流程"],"update_time": "2024-03-15"}
-
对话引擎模块
基于DeepSeek模型构建语义理解层,需重点优化:- 意图识别准确率(建议训练集覆盖90%以上业务场景)
- 实体抽取精度(使用BiLSTM+CRF模型处理复杂命名实体)
- 对话状态跟踪(DST模块维护上下文记忆)
典型对话流程示例:
用户:我想查下本月的考勤→ 意图识别:考勤查询→ 实体抽取:时间范围=本月→ 知识库检索:关联考勤制度文档→ 生成回复:您本月出勤22天,迟到1次...
二、知识库构建:从数据到智能的转化
-
数据清洗与标注
- 使用正则表达式清洗非结构化文本(如去除HTML标签、特殊符号)
- 采用BERT-based模型进行语义相似度计算,合并重复问题
- 人工标注关键数据点(如政策生效日期、联系方式等)
-
多模态知识融合
支持文本、图片、表格混合存储:# 伪代码:多模态知识检索示例def search_knowledge(query):text_results = vector_db.similarity_search(query)image_results = ocr_engine.search_screenshots(query)table_results = sql_engine.query_tables(query)return merge_results(text_results, image_results, table_results)
-
版本控制机制
实现知识条目的生命周期管理:- 草稿态→审核态→发布态的三态流转
- 历史版本保留(建议至少保留3个版本)
- 变更影响分析(自动标记关联问题)
三、DeepSeek模型集成:从基础到进阶
-
模型微调策略
- 使用Lora技术进行参数高效微调,降低计算资源消耗
- 构建领域专用语料库(建议10万条以上对话数据)
- 采用RLHF(人类反馈强化学习)优化回复质量
微调参数配置示例:
training_args:learning_rate: 3e-5batch_size: 32epochs: 5warmup_steps: 500
-
多轮对话管理
实现上下文感知的对话策略:- 槽位填充机制(收集用户必要信息)
- 对话修复策略(当用户表述模糊时主动澄清)
- 转移机制(无法解答时转人工)
对话状态跟踪示例:
class DialogState:def __init__(self):self.intent = Noneself.slots = {} # {slot_name: value}self.history = [] # 保存最近5轮对话
-
性能优化技巧
- 模型量化:将FP32模型转为INT8,减少内存占用
- 缓存常用回复:对高频问题预生成回复
- 异步处理:非实时任务(如日志记录)采用消息队列
四、部署与运维:保障系统稳定性
-
混合云部署方案
- 私有化部署核心知识库(保障数据安全)
- 公有云部署对话引擎(弹性扩展)
- 使用Kubernetes管理容器化服务
-
监控告警体系
关键监控指标:- 平均响应时间(P99<1.5s)
- 意图识别准确率(>90%)
- 知识库命中率(>85%)
-
持续迭代机制
- 每周分析对话日志,发现知识盲点
- 每月进行模型再训练
- 每季度评估系统ROI
五、典型应用场景实践
-
企业HR客服
- 集成考勤、薪酬、福利等子系统
- 支持证件照OCR识别
- 实现7×24小时政策咨询
-
学校教务客服
- 课程表查询
- 成绩分析
- 选课指导
-
行业特色适配
- 医疗场景:添加症状初筛功能
- 金融场景:集成合规性检查
六、注意事项与最佳实践
-
数据安全合规
- 个人信息脱敏处理
- 符合等保2.0三级要求
- 审计日志保留至少6个月
-
用户体验优化
- 提供多渠道接入(网页/APP/企业微信)
- 支持语音转文字
- 设计人性化的话术模板
-
成本控制建议
- 初期采用SaaS模式快速验证
- 成熟后转向私有化部署
- 使用GPU共享技术降低算力成本
通过上述方法论,企业或教育机构可在3-6周内完成智能客服系统的搭建与上线。实际案例显示,采用DeepSeek模型的系统相比传统规则引擎,问题解决率提升40%以上,人力成本降低60%。建议从核心业务场景切入,逐步扩展功能边界,最终实现全流程自动化服务。